On Tuesday, September 10, 2019, An-Najah's Nutrition and Food Technology Department participated in the 2nd evaluation and kick-off workshop for the joint German-Palestinian projects funded under PALGER 2015 & 2017 in Ramallah.


The event was jointly organized by the Palestinian Ministry of Higher Education (MoHE) and the Federal Ministry of Education and Research (BMBF) in cooperation with DLR-PT.

The PALGER funding programme is intended to establish long-term German-Palestinian research cooperation and thus strengthen the sustainability of Palestinian universities and research institutions. Its focus is particularly on junior scientists.

The event provided a forum for Palestinian and German PIs of the first and second PALGER cycles to share their impressions, to engage in technical and cooperation exchanges, and to give recommendations for improving future research collaboration within the framework of the PALGER funding programme.

A total of 14 projects were funded under the first joint call 'PALGER 2015' in 2016-2019. In September 2018, the bilateral Steering Committee confirmed the joint funding of 14 other projects from the second round of calls for 'PALGER 2017'. These will now be funded in the period 2019-2021.

One of these projects was of Dr. Manal Badrasawi from the Nutrition and Food Technology Department who gave a presentation on the project on behalf of the German partner.
